Background technique
Since commercially producing since the nineteen twenty-nine sodium alginate, countries in the world production sodium alginate is substantially all made of pure Alkali digestion technique makes the alginate in seaweed be converted into sol form sodium alginate and is dissolved in the water, then uses calcium with lye Salt purifies seaweed acid group, is acidified again later as alginic acid, finally in alcohol in caustic soda and obtaining the alginic acid of high-purity Sodium.This traditional handicraft process is many and diverse, and soda ash digestion process will consume a large amount of alkali, it is subsequent closely follow rush dilute technique can expend and A large amount of water.100-150 times that dilute process water consumption is about dry brown alga is rushed, the water consumption for producing 1 ton of sodium alginate finished product is caused Amount is about 700 tons, and water consumption is huge.Process modification how to be carried out to achieve the purpose that water conservation, becomes the industry urgently It solves the problems, such as.
Sodium alginate mainly plays thickening, emulsification and gelatification as natural edible colloid, in food every profession and trade extensively It uses.Sodium alginate is applied mainly utilizes its thickening property and gel water-retaining property in meat products.In recent years, it is with Russia markets Leading, the trend of globalization is presented in application of the sodium alginate in meat products direction.Since sodium alginate is calcium ion responsive type colloid, It can not independent gel, it is necessary to suitable calcium salt and phosphate is added, is made into composite buffering gel rubber system, can just form uniform gel, Therefore compounding alginate formulations come into being.It is normal to compound alginates (based on sodium alginate, adding suitable calcium salt and phosphate) By as meat products tumbling agent, injection and fat subsitutes product etc., it is widely used in high and low temperature meat products.
But common compound alginate formulations product is realized by simple mixing procedure, sodium alginate in the method, Phosphate cannot be merged with calcium salt well, and the too fast problem of gel local reaction easily occurs after dissolution, leads to product structure not Uniform, texture and water retention property are deteriorated.
Summary of the invention
The present invention is directed to state of the art, provides a kind of meat products specific complex alginates cleanly production technique, Including the step such as the immersion of dry brown alga, compound biological enzyme enzymatic hydrolysis, calcification, squeezing, reverse washing, squeezing, ion exchange, granulation, drying Suddenly.The production technology uses ion exchange technique, carries out solid-state ion exchange with composite phosphate and calcium alginate fibre, It is eventually converted into compound alginate.Meanwhile using whole fibrosis production method, it is huge to eliminate water consumption in traditional handicraft Digestion rush dilute step, water resource is greatly saved, reduces production cost.Using reverse washing process, life has been saved again Fisheries water.
The present invention is the high-valued development and utilization to alginic acid technology of threonates, simplifies production process, from technique On realize the production of the alginates with specific application area.
For achieving the above object, the present invention, which adopts the following technical solutions, is achieved:
A kind of meat products specific complex alginates cleanly production technique, comprising the following steps:
(1) dry brown alga is impregnated: brown alga being put into abundant rehydration in enzymatic vessel, amount of water is about 8-10 times, when rehydration Between: 2-8h;
(2) complex enzyme zymohydrolysis: enzymatic vessel temperature is adjusted to 40-55 DEG C, pH 4.5-5.5, and complex enzyme (cellulose is added Enzyme: pectase=1:1.2-1.5), additional amount is dry brown alga weight 1-3%, enzyme digestion reaction 3-5h, it is therefore an objective to by fruit in brown alga Glue, cellulose etc. decompose completely;
(3) calcification: calcium chloride being added into enzymatic vessel, until calcium chloride concentration is 5% or so, fills seaweed acid group therein Divide calcification, is converted into fibrous calcium alginate;
(4) reverse washing: with being in 30 ° of angles with ground, length is that calcium alginate fibre is risen to a high position by 8 meters of conveyer belt, Multiple water jets are accessed at the rear (at 4-4.5 rice) of conveyer belt, spraying-rinsing processing repeatedly is carried out to calcium alginate on a small quantity.With Water washes the impurity such as the pectin digested and fiber, and filtered cleaning solution can be used as impregnating the soak of dry brown alga, residue For making alga fertilizer;
(5) it squeezes: calcium alginate fibre being subjected to press dewatering with twin rollers;
(6) ion exchange: dewatered calcium alginate fibre is put into neutralizing tank, with composite phosphate (sodium pyrophosphate: Sodium tripolyphosphate: sodium polyphosphate=1:2-4:1-3) solid-state ion exchange is carried out, sentenced with universal indicator chromogenic reaction Disconnected reaction end, wherein calcium alginate: phosphate (in terms of phosphate radical)=2.5-4.5:1;
(7) it is granulated: being granulated with pelletizer;
(8) it crushes, obtain meat products specific complex alginate after drying.
In the step (2), complex enzyme is protease, cellulase and pectase, wherein protease: cellulase: fruit Glue enzyme=1:1:1.2-1.5;
In the step (4), reverse washing transports calcium alginate fibre using conveyer belt, and conveyer belt parameter is that length is 7- 8 meters, it is in 30 ° of angles with ground, can facilitates and calcium alginate fibre is risen into a high position, is accessed at the rear (at 3.5-4 rice) of conveyer belt Multiple water jets repeatedly carry out spraying-rinsing processing to calcium alginate on a small quantity.This mode is conducive to improve flush efficiency and water-saving.
In the step (6), phosphatic type is sodium pyrophosphate, sodium tripolyphosphate and sodium polyphosphate.
In the step (6), mass ratio=2.5-4.5:1 of calcium alginate and phosphate (in terms of phosphate radical).
In the step (8), compound alginate because its with dissolubility and it is sequestering can also be used in dairy products, daily use chemicals, In beverage, makees thickener, stabilizer, emulsifier and coagulator and use.
The present invention improves in terms of having following six compared with current sodium alginate production technology:
1) complex enzyme zymohydrolysis brown alga removes the other structures ingredient other than algal polysaccharide by complex enzyme hydrolysis mode, improves Reaction efficiency, saves the reaction time, has saved water consumption;
2) direct calcification after digesting, and process (sol form process) is digested without tradition, realize full technical process Fibrosis production, simplifies production process, reduces the dosage of chemicals, protect polysaccharide structures from the root, ensure that The high viscosity of sodium alginate;
3) reverse washing process is used, a small amount of repeatedly washing is significantly more efficient to remove the impurity taken off in calcification process, protects Product purity is demonstrate,proved;
4) dilute technical process is rushed without tradition, substantially reduces water consumption, and water scouring water is Ke Xunhuanliyong after calcification, it is real The production of high-efficiency cleaning metaplasia is showed;
5) method for using ion exchange, allows alkaline phosphate and calcium alginate that solid phase neutralization reaction directly occurs, saves Traditional decalcification technique, simplifies the technological process of production;
6) compound alginates prepared by the present invention are embedded with sodium, calcium ion using algal polysaccharides segment as main chain simultaneously on segment, And there are electrostatic interactions with phosphate radical.Will not occur topical gel reaction, excellent aqueous solubility, and in conjunction with meat albumen after Uniform gel is formed, meat products texture can be significantly improved, reduces cooking loss, improves meat products water-retaining property.
